Once you’ve followed just a few people for about a week, and noticed what they are tweeting about, then it’s time to find some more tweeters. Take things slowly at first, if you’re new to this. Learn the basics, then ramp things up.

When you start following people, most of them will follow you, so the best way to get followers, is to Follow people yourself.

An easy way to find followers, is to Follow another Tweeters’ followers. Here’s how to do that.

  1. Look at the Image below – it is Mari Smith’s Twitter page (find it at www.twitter.com/marismith ) On the right hand side under her Bio, you can see there are 60,693 people that she is Following. And, she has 62,257 followers.
  2. Once your logged in to Twitter, go to Mari Smith’s twitter page and Click where it says “followers”.
  3. Now you will see a list of all of Mari Smith’s followers. To the right of each follower you will see 3 buttons, hold your mouse over the first button, which will look similar to this: follow tweeters button
  4. Now, just click on that button – the one that says “Follow…… ” when you hold your mouse over it. Now you’re following that person.
  5. Follow a few people on the page if you like the “sound” of them (you can always unfollow them if you don’t like them).
